Highlights
- Glendale spends 4.3% less per student than Napa.
- The Student Teacher Ratio is 4.7% lower in Glendale than in Napa. (lower means fewer students in each classroom).
- Glendale had 5.3% more residents who had graduated High School compared to Napa
